In other Glee news (spoilers here, obviously), tvline.com's Michael Ausiello is reporting that Gwyneth Paltrow will be returning for 1 (and maybe 2) more episode(s), starting on March 8. She will get more involved with Matthew Morrison's Will Schuester, and the two of them will sing a duet of Prince's "Kiss". Cannot. Wait.
Also, the Glee tour dates have been announced for this summer's tour. They're not coming to the south, but here are the dates for all who are interested:
May 21/Las Vegas, NV/Mandalay Bay Event Center
May 22/Sacramento, CA/Arco Arena
May 24/San Jose, CA/HP Pavilion
May 27/Anaheim, CAHonda Center
May 28/Los Angeles, CA/Staples Center
May 29/San Diego, CA/ Valley View Casino Center
June 1/Minneapolis, MN/Target Center
June 2/Indianapolis, IN/Conseco Fieldhouse
June 3 /Chicago, IL/Allstate Arena
June 6/Boston, MA/TD Garden
June 8/Philadelphia, PA/Wells Fargo Center
June 11/Toronto, Canada/Air Canada Centre
June 13/Detroit, MI/Palace of Auburn Hills
June 14/Cleveland, OH/Quicken Loans Arena
June 16/East Rutherford, NJ/Izod Center
June 18/Uniondale, NY/Nassau Colliseum
Castmembers on the tour will be: Lea Michele (Rachel), Cory Monteith (Finn), Amber Riley (Mercedes), Chris Colfer (Kurt), Kevin McHale (Artie), Jenna Ushkowitz (Tina), Mark Salling (Puck), Dianna Agron (Quinn), Naya Rivera (Santana), Heather Morris (Brittany), Harry Shum, Jr. (Mike), as well as recurring cast members Chord Overstreet (Sam) and Darren Criss (Blaine).
